... to fit an aftermarket Alpine (IDA-100 ipod only version) to my 57 plate R32 whilst still utilising the full functionality of the steering wheel controls and highline?? Currently have an RCD300

Have read various conflicting information on the net - something about no illuminated feed (what ever that means) and various other crap that means diddly squat to me.

You will need a CANBUS adaptor to obtain all the benefits such as auto dimming lights at night and ignition live switch etc etc . I am however not 100% with regards to keeping the MFSW controls, Im pretty sure it does though as all that information is constrained within the twined cables going into the CANBUS.
